
Nathan's Famous Skinless Beef Franks 12 oz
What You Should Know
Nathan's Famous Skinless Beef Franks (12 oz) lands in the refrigerated meat aisle, usually on a shelf alongside other hot dogs, frankfurters, and packaged lunch meats. You’ll often find it near other American comfort staples — buns, condiments, and barbecue sauces — making it an easy grab for quick meals. This product fits casual shopping trips: last-minute cookout runs, weeknight grocery stops for kid-friendly dinners, and party prep for game-day crowd-pleasing menus. Nathan’s positions itself as a heritage brand with Coney Island roots, leaning into classic American ballpark and backyard barbecue imagery. The marketing angle skews mainstream and family-focused, evoking nostalgia and approachable value rather than gourmet or organic luxury. Labels typically emphasize “beef” and recognizable brand history; the ingredient list includes “natural flavorings,” which can create a mild health halo, but there’s no organic certification or explicit ‘‘all-natural’’ seal. The pack is a plastic vacuum or overwrap pouch holding a cluster of skinless franks — convenient, shelf-ready, and easy to toss on a grill or into a pan. In plain language, these are processed meat sausages made with beef plus functional additives and preservatives (e.g., sodium nitrite, sodium phosphates, hydrolyzed proteins) to stabilize flavor and shelf life. Sensory-wise, the franks are soft and juicy rather than snappy, with a uniform, slightly springy bite and savory, slightly smoky notes from paprika and curing agents. Rituals around them are simple and communal: grilled at backyard barbecues, steamed in city diners, or sliced into kid lunches with mustard and a warm bun.

Ultra-Processing Assessment
Ultra-Processed
Why this score?
Contains processed meat with multiple industrial additives (sodium nitrite, phosphates, sorbitol, hydrolyzed corn protein, natural flavorings) and is formulated for long shelf life and uniform texture, fitting the NOVA ultra-processed category.
